Career
Webster leads the clinical program in pediatric electrophysiology at Ann and Robert H. Lurie Children's Hospital of Chicago. His research focuses on risk stratification for arrhythmia and sudden death in children and young adults. His team provides advanced analysis of genetic risk and develops translational solutions to reduce risk for patients and families. He has advocacy experience as the founder of Chicagoland Cardiac Connections, a community support network for children with pacemakers and defibrillators, and serves on the board of directors for the Foundation for Inherited Arrhythmias
